Output ddcde0df2b0313cbfa2283aee44cc2d7c1882ea16df2b401310effafd1559f60:39

value
1668544
script pubkey
OP_0 OP_PUSHBYTES_20 c12806c39fa5c9e7cfadcec61c621a3efac0ce28
address
bc1qcy5qdsul5hy70nademrpccs68mavpn3gxalzxp
transaction
ddcde0df2b0313cbfa2283aee44cc2d7c1882ea16df2b401310effafd1559f60
confirmations
25670
spent
true